The Doodlebug Design Lots of Love collection has stolen my heart! I decided to make 10 super-simple mini cards to hand out and an A2-sized card using the patterned papers and die cut shapes from the collection. It’s a busy time of year when I’m writing the magazine, so I decided to keep things simple, and patterned papers and ephemera are always perfect for quick cuteness with awesome results!

The first set of mini Valentine’s Day cards were created from one 6 x 6 inch piece of patterned paper. I cut the paper in four and rounded each corner, added a strip of aqua cardstock, tied on a twine bow, and added a cute die cut shape popped up on foam tape.

The second set of mini Valentine’s Day cards were created from two 6 x 6 inch pieces of patterned paper. I trimmed six 3 inch square cardstock mats in red, yellow, and aqua. Next I trimmed the patterned paper backgrounds to 2.75 inches square and adhered them to the mats. Finally, I popped up another cute die cut with foam tape on each.
